A,B and C can complete a job in 10 days, working together. But only two of them can work together at a time. If all of them work for the same number of days with equal efficiency, how many days would each one have worked for when the job is completed?

A. 8 days

B. 12 days

C. 15 days

D. 10 days

Solution (By Examveda Team)

Let there be 30 units of work. Each day 3 units are completed. So each of A,B and C would do 1 unit per day. So, if A,B work on day 1 they would complete 2 units. Similarly, (B,C) and (C,A) do 2 units per day. So when the job is completed that is at the end of 15 days each one would have worked for 10 days.

Alternative method:
Since each one works for equal number of days they would each have done the same amount of work. Hence, they would each do 10 units, i.e. in 10 days.
